Page 1 of 1

Files not appearing in shares but have links still

Posted: Fri Oct 07, 2011 9:54 pm
by bellamatt
I have a problem with my shares - after working fine for several months all the files appear to have vanished from the main directory, but when looking in the /var/hda/files/ directory they appear as links:

Code: Select all

lrwxrwxrwx 1 matt users 112 2011-01-09 02:24 P1010113.JPG -> /var/hda/files/drives/drive1/gh/Pictures/Family photo album/Home + Family/Our family/2007/200701Jan/P1010113.JPG
These files do not appear in the share (in this case, /mnt/samba/Pictures/ ...)

The other day I was trying to get a squeezebox app working and may have changed some permissions on the files, I suspect this is what messed it up but I am not sure what to do to fix it.

Following the troubleshooting guide:

Code: Select all

[root@desktop 200701Jan]# uname -r; rpm -q samba hda-greyhole 2.6.32.26-175.fc12.x86_64 samba-3.4.9-60.fc12.x86_64 hda-greyhole-0.7.5-1.x86_64
samba.conf
http://fpaste.org/Fudb/

greyhole.conf
http://fpaste.org/NeLV/

Code: Select all

[root@desktop 200701Jan]# mount; fdisk -l; df -h; greyhole --stats /dev/sda3 on / type ext4 (rw) proc on /proc type proc (rw) sysfs on /sys type sysfs (rw) devpts on /dev/pts type devpts (rw,gid=5,mode=620) tmpfs on /dev/shm type tmpfs (rw) /dev/sda1 on /boot type ext3 (rw) /dev/sda4 on /var/hda/files type ext4 (rw) /dev/sdb1 on /var/hda/files/drives/drive1 type ext4 (rw) /dev/sdc1 on /var/hda/files/drives/drive3 type ext4 (rw) /dev/sdd1 on /var/hda/files/drives/drive4 type ext4 (rw) none on /proc/sys/fs/binfmt_misc type binfmt_misc (rw) sunrpc on /var/lib/nfs/rpc_pipefs type rpc_pipefs (rw) gvfs-fuse-daemon on /home/matt/.gvfs type fuse.gvfs-fuse-daemon (rw,nosuid,nodev,user=matt) //127.0.0.1/archivemusic on /mnt/samba/archivemusic type cifs (rw,mand) //127.0.0.1/Books on /mnt/samba/Books type cifs (rw,mand) //127.0.0.1/Docs on /mnt/samba/Docs type cifs (rw,mand) //127.0.0.1/Downloads on /mnt/samba/Downloads type cifs (rw,mand) //127.0.0.1/Movies on /mnt/samba/Movies type cifs (rw,mand) //127.0.0.1/music on /mnt/samba/music type cifs (rw,mand) //127.0.0.1/Music on /mnt/samba/Music type cifs (rw,mand) //127.0.0.1/Pictures on /mnt/samba/Pictures type cifs (rw,mand) //127.0.0.1/Torrents on /mnt/samba/Torrents type cifs (rw,mand) Disk /dev/sda: 500.1 GB, 500107862016 bytes 255 heads, 63 sectors/track, 60801 cylinders Units = cylinders of 16065 * 512 = 8225280 bytes Disk identifier: 0x000442c8 Device Boot Start End Blocks Id System /dev/sda1 * 1 26 208813+ 83 Linux /dev/sda2 27 287 2096482+ 82 Linux swap / Solaris /dev/sda3 288 2212 15462562+ 83 Linux /dev/sda4 2213 60801 470616142+ 83 Linux Disk /dev/sdb: 1000.2 GB, 1000204886016 bytes 255 heads, 63 sectors/track, 121601 cylinders Units = cylinders of 16065 * 512 = 8225280 bytes Disk identifier: 0x29f4fcca Device Boot Start End Blocks Id System /dev/sdb1 1 121602 976760832 83 Linux Disk /dev/sdc: 2000.4 GB, 2000398934016 bytes 255 heads, 63 sectors/track, 243201 cylinders Units = cylinders of 16065 * 512 = 8225280 bytes Disk identifier: 0x000064fa Device Boot Start End Blocks Id System /dev/sdc1 1 243202 1953513472 83 Linux Disk /dev/sdd: 2000.4 GB, 2000396746752 bytes 255 heads, 63 sectors/track, 243201 cylinders Units = cylinders of 16065 * 512 = 8225280 bytes Disk identifier: 0x0018f92d Device Boot Start End Blocks Id System /dev/sdd1 1 243202 1953511424 83 Linux Filesystem Size Used Avail Use% Mounted on /dev/sda3 15G 5.3G 8.6G 38% / tmpfs 1005M 392K 1005M 1% /dev/shm /dev/sda1 198M 41M 148M 22% /boot /dev/sda4 442G 180G 240G 43% /var/hda/files /dev/sdb1 917G 399G 472G 46% /var/hda/files/drives/drive1 /dev/sdc1 1.8T 277G 1.5T 16% /var/hda/files/drives/drive3 /dev/sdd1 1.8T 416G 1.3T 24% /var/hda/files/drives/drive4 //127.0.0.1/archivemusic 442G 202G 240G 46% /mnt/samba/archivemusic //127.0.0.1/Books 3.2T 1017G 2.2T 32% /mnt/samba/Books //127.0.0.1/Docs 3.2T 1017G 2.2T 32% /mnt/samba/Docs //127.0.0.1/Downloads 3.2T 1017G 2.2T 32% /mnt/samba/Downloads //127.0.0.1/Movies 3.2T 1017G 2.2T 32% /mnt/samba/Movies //127.0.0.1/music 3.2T 1017G 2.2T 32% /mnt/samba/music //127.0.0.1/Music 3.2T 1017G 2.2T 32% /mnt/samba/Music //127.0.0.1/Pictures 3.2T 1017G 2.2T 32% /mnt/samba/Pictures //127.0.0.1/Torrents 3.2T 1017G 2.2T 32% /mnt/samba/Torrents Greyhole Statistics =================== Storage Pool Total - Used = Free + Attic = Possible /var/hda/files/gh: 442G - 179G = 240G + 0G = 240G /var/hda/files/drives/drive1/gh: 917G - 398G = 472G + 71G = 543G /var/hda/files/drives/drive3/gh: 1834G - 276G = 1464G + 0G = 1464G

Code: Select all

[root@desktop 200701Jan]# mysql -u root -phda -e "select * from disk_pool_partitions" hda_production +----+------------------------------+--------------+---------------------+---------------------+ | id | path | minimum_free | created_at | updated_at | +----+------------------------------+--------------+---------------------+---------------------+ | 1 | /var/hda/files | 10 | 2011-01-07 05:51:22 | 2011-01-07 05:51:22 | | 2 | /var/hda/files/drives/drive1 | 10 | 2011-01-07 05:51:23 | 2011-01-07 05:51:23 | | 3 | /var/hda/files/drives/drive3 | 10 | 2011-04-26 00:19:38 | 2011-04-26 00:19:38 | +----+------------------------------+--------------+---------------------+---------------------+

Code: Select all

[root@desktop 200701Jan]# mysql -u root -phda -e "select concat(path, '/gh') from disk_pool_partitions" hda_production | grep -v 'concat(' | xargs ls -la | fpaste Uploading (1.4K)...
http://fpaste.org/1x7a/

Code: Select all

[root@desktop 200701Jan]# greyhole --view-queue Greyhole Work Queue Statistics ============================== This table gives you the number of pending operations queued for the Greyhole daemon, per share. Write Delete Rename Can't find # of writes in tasks table: no such table: tasks

Code: Select all

[matt@desktop ~]$ tail /var/log/greyhole.log Oct 8 14:19:15 2 daemon: Can't query settings for 'graveyard_backup_directory': no such table: settings Oct 8 14:20:45 6 daemon: Greyhole (version 0.7.5) daemon started. Oct 8 14:20:45 7 daemon: Loading graveyard backup directories... Oct 8 14:20:45 2 daemon: Can't query settings for 'graveyard_backup_directory': no such table: settings Oct 8 14:21:46 6 daemon: Greyhole (version 0.7.5) daemon started. Oct 8 14:21:46 7 daemon: Loading graveyard backup directories... Oct 8 14:21:46 2 daemon: Can't query settings for 'graveyard_backup_directory': no such table: settings Oct 8 15:16:09 6 daemon: Greyhole (version 0.7.5) daemon started. Oct 8 15:16:09 7 daemon: Loading graveyard backup directories... Oct 8 15:16:09 2 daemon: Can't query settings for 'graveyard_backup_directory': no such table: settings

Re: Files not appearing in shares but have links still

Posted: Fri Oct 07, 2011 11:59 pm
by bellamatt
think i may have fixed this with

Code: Select all

chown -R matt:users /var/hda/files/ greyhole --fsck
The logs still seem to have database errors though so not sure what's going on with that. However all the files are now displaying properly on the shares.